valorised

[ˈvæləraɪzd]

valorised Definition

  • 1to give value or worth to something
  • 2to ascribe importance or merit to something

Summary: valorised in Brief

The verb 'valorised' [ˈvæləraɪzd] means to give value or worth to something, or to ascribe importance or merit to it. It is often used in the context of recognizing and praising someone's contributions or achievements, as in 'The company has valorised its employees' contributions to the project.' The opposite of valorising is devaluing or belittling.
